**Checklist item 14 — ORM migration readiness.** Plugin authors targeting the Varnholt SDK should verify their data hooks no longer call the deprecated QuillMap ORM directly. The legacy layer is being refactored into the new Lattice adapter during the Q3 audit window, and any plugin relying on raw session objects will break. Confirm your extension passes the compatibility suite before resubmission. Direct all refactor questions to the migration lead named below.

account owner for bawip-tahag: Raleth Quenok

The Quillbase migration pipeline applies schema changes with zero downtime: expand, backfill, contract, in that order. Dual-write flags live in the Lanternmere config service; never flip contract before backfill verification passes. All migration jobs run under the restricted migrator role, audited nightly. The only standing secret is the migration vault credential, rotated quarterly. If the vault locks mid-migration, recovery is manual. Orvald, use the passphrase below to reopen the migration vault.

vault phrase of bageg-kadug = aldax-oliiel-aldiel-pelix-kasax-quenath-olieth-drudor-pelys-praiel

**Vendor note: Inkmill markdown pipeline**

Rendering for Parchway docs is outsourced to Inkmill under an annual contract, renewing each March. They handle sanitization and PDF export; we own the upload queue. SLA: 4-hour response on rendering failures. Escalate only after two failed retries. Their support desk is reachable at the address below.

billing contact of hahaf-baguf = zorael.tammir.jorius@sivrelhq.internal

## Sensor drift: what to do at 3am

If the GrowLoop controller starts reporting humidity swings that don't match the backup probes in the Fernwick greenhouse, it's almost always sensor drift, not an actual climate event. Don't panic and don't touch the vents manually. First, restart the calibration daemon and give it ten minutes to re-baseline. If readings still disagree by more than 5%, flip the controller into safe mode. The safe-mode thresholds it will use are these.

config for yahap-bajof:
[istix]
host = istix.qorvelsys.internal
user = istix_svc
database = istix_prod